Virtuix Holdings Inc. (NASDAQ:VTIX – Get Free Report) COO David Robert Malcolm Allan sold 78,259 shares of Virtuix stock in a transaction dated Thursday, July 30th. The stock was sold at an average price of $1.56, for a total value of $122,084.04.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ief operating officer owned 126,650 shares in the company, valued at $197,574. The trade was a 38.19%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which can be accessed through the SEC website.
David Robert Malcolm Allan also recently made the following trade(s):
- On Wednesday, July 29th, David Robert Malcolm Allan sold 74,270 shares of Virtuix stock. The shares were sold at an average price of $1.60, for a total value of $118,832.00.
- On Tuesday, July 28th, David Robert Malcolm Allan sold 220,821 shares of Virtuix st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$1.79, for a total value of $395,269.59.

Virtuix Company Profile
Virtuix (NASDAQ:VTIX) is a company that develops and commercializes hardware and software for immersive virtual reality (VR) locomotion and related experiences. Its core focus is on enabling natural movement inside virtual environments through purpose-built platforms and systems that pair motion-control hardware with software integrations for games, training and location-based entertainment.
The company is best known for its Omni family of omnidirectional locomotion platforms, which are designed to allow users to walk, run and maneuver in 360 degrees within a virtual space while remaining stationary in the real world.
